This is a drawing of a rustic scene with two figures engaged in labor. The image depicts a rugged outdoor setting where one figure is plowing the earth using a rudimentary tool. Beside the plowing figure, another figure with a skeletal appearance is depicted. A third figure sits in the background, appearing to hold an infant. The heavy use of lines and stark contrast creates a dramatic effect. The text above the scene reads "Adam bawgt die erden." The detailed engraving style emphasizes the textures of the ground and surrounding elements.
